Output efbc16fdd8552b92205e1f46f8a5b407c07838c5eb1193571182bf494e168dfc:0

value
1659660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fac09982d0065d6508aa0df7e6561a2817caf3ab OP_EQUAL
address
3QYsaZRRykF4bStpVMxvAPsfMerjtfd6FB
transaction
efbc16fdd8552b92205e1f46f8a5b407c07838c5eb1193571182bf494e168dfc
confirmations
388514
spent
true